
On Sunday, the 2012 NCAA Men's Basketball Tournament completed the last 2 regional finals setting up the Final 4 for New Orleans!
This year the Final 4 schools are Kentucky, Louisville, Kansas & Ohio State. The field consists of a #1 seed, a #4 seed & 2 #2 seeds.
According to the sports books Kentucky is the odds on favorite at 4-5 with Louisville the dark horse at 6-1. Kansas & Ohio State are both 4-1.
The Final 4 will start Saturday March 31st at 3:09 PST with the Kentucky Wildcats facing former coach Rick Pitino & their in-state rival Louisville Cardinals in the 1st National Semi-Final.
The 2nd matchup of the night will feature the 2nd seeded Ohio State Buckeyes vs fellow 2 seed Kansas Jayhawks. Ohio State & Kansas have combined to lose 9 National Championship games so both teams will be looking for more then a Monday night matchup with the boys from the Blue Grass State.
The National Championship will take place Monday April 2nd at 5PM PST LIVE on CBS(Channel 8) from the New Orleans Superdome.
